Stunting prevalence among children under 5 years of age (%) in Egypt
Egypt: Stunting prevalence among children under 5 years of age (%) was 12.9% in 2024. ▼ Falling
Stunting prevalence among children under 5 years of age (%) in Egypt, 2000–2024
Source: World Health Organization, Global Health Observatory.
Analysis
Egypt recorded 12.9% for stunting prevalence among children under 5 years of age (%) in 2024. That is the lowest value across all 25 years on record.
The figure is down 1.5% on the previous year and down 37.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, stunting prevalence among children under 5 years of age (%) in Egypt peaked at 25.9% in 2000 and was at its lowest, 12.9%, in 2024.
That places Egypt 78th out of 161 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 25 years of available data.
Stunting prevalence among children under 5 years of age (%) in Egypt,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2000 | 25.9% | — |
| 2001 | 25.8% | -0.4% |
| 2002 | 25.7% | -0.4% |
| 2003 | 25.5% | -0.8% |
| 2004 | 25.4% | -0.4% |
| 2005 | 25.3% | -0.4% |
| 2006 | 25.4% | +0.4% |
| 2007 | 25.4% | +0.0% |
| 2008 | 25.5% | +0.4% |
| 2009 | 25.6% | +0.4% |
| 2010 | 25.4% | -0.8% |
| 2011 | 24.7% | -2.8% |
| 2012 | 23.5% | -4.9% |
| 2013 | 22.0% | -6.4% |
| 2014 | 20.5% | -6.8% |
| 2015 | 19.2% | -6.3% |
| 2016 | 18.1% | -5.7% |
| 2017 | 17.1% | -5.5% |
| 2018 | 16.1% | -5.8% |
| 2019 | 15.2% | -5.6% |
| 2020 | 14.4% | -5.3% |
| 2021 | 13.7% | -4.9% |
| 2022 | 13.4% | -2.2% |
| 2023 | 13.1% | -2.2% |
| 2024 | 12.9% | -1.5% |
Egypt compared with similar countries
- Egypt's 12.9% is below the median for lower middle income countries, which is 21.2%, 61% of the median. (46 countries reporting)
- Egypt's 12.9% is above the median for Middle East, North Africa, Afghanistan & Pakistan, which is 9.4%, 1.4× the median. (21 countries reporting)
